在Debian系統中配置Composer(一種PHP依賴管理工具)通常涉及以下幾個步驟:
首先,你需要確保你的系統上已經安裝了PHP。你可以通過以下命令檢查PHP是否已安裝:
php -v
如果PHP未安裝,可以使用以下命令安裝:
sudo apt update
sudo apt install php
接下來,使用以下命令下載并安裝Composer:
curl -sS https://getcomposer.org/installer | php
sudo mv composer.phar /usr/local/bin/composer
安裝完成后,你可以通過編輯Composer的配置文件來配置它。Composer的配置文件通常位于用戶主目錄下的.composer目錄中,文件名為config.json。
你可以使用以下命令創建或編輯配置文件:
mkdir -p ~/.composer
nano ~/.composer/config.json
在config.json文件中,你可以添加各種配置選項。例如,設置存儲庫的默認URL:
{
"repo-packagist-org": {
"type": "composer",
"url": "https://packagist.org"
}
}
配置完成后,你可以開始使用Composer來管理你的PHP項目依賴。以下是一些常用的Composer命令:
初始化項目:
composer init
安裝依賴:
composer require <package-name>
更新依賴:
composer update
卸載依賴:
composer remove <package-name>
查看已安裝的包:
composer show
如果你希望全局配置Composer,可以在全局配置文件中進行設置。全局配置文件通常位于/etc/composer.json或~/.composer/config.json。
例如,設置全局的存儲庫URL:
{
"repo-packagist-org": {
"type": "composer",
"url": "https://packagist.org"
}
}
你還可以通過設置環境變量來配置Composer。例如,設置COMPOSER_HOME環境變量來指定Composer的全局配置目錄:
export COMPOSER_HOME=~/.composer
將上述命令添加到你的~/.bashrc或~/.profile文件中,以便每次登錄時自動設置。
通過以上步驟,你應該能夠在Debian系統中成功配置和使用Composer。